Transaction d12f04e29b201044d7ee23a82367370312b18306d4525b34a503b71e3e368a16
1 Input
2 Outputs
- d12f04e29b201044d7ee23a82367370312b18306d4525b34a503b71e3e368a16:0
- d12f04e29b201044d7ee23a82367370312b18306d4525b34a503b71e3e368a16:1
value 635366
address 3BvhkHW47Fh6LDh54SV3GiqbN5a4TKTtpK
value 17338912
address 18nuQY3fKXrXKt3XDGz7pTgr7xnWaovEEw